Located in the heart of Athens, the Hilton Athens boasts elegant rooms, a rooftop Galaxy bar restaurant and state-of-the-art meeting rooms.
Set in Athens and with Acropolis Museum reachable within 200 metres, Niche Hotel Athens offers concierge services, allergy-free rooms, a…
With a prime location, opposite Constitution Square and the House of Parliament, the Grande Bretagne features luxurious rooms and stunning…
The classically designed Titania is conveniently nestled in the historic and commercial centre of Athens.
Conveniently located in Athens city center and just steps from Metaxourgeio Metro Station, Stanley Hotel features a rooftop pool, 2…
Located in the heart of Athens’ business and commercial district, Crowne Plaza offers lavish accommodations within walking distance of…
Just steps from Metaxourgeio Metro Station, the modern Wyndham Grand Athens features a rooftop outdoor pool and bar-restaurant with…
With an excellent location in Athens city centre, 2 minutes' walk from Syntagma Square and close to all the historical sites, Hotel…
Located in the heart of Athens and 1640 feet from Panormou Metro Station, President Hotel offers comfortable accommodations and a beautiful…
Set in Athens, 4.8 km from Omonia Metro Station, Green Suites Boutique Hotel offers accommodation with a seasonal outdoor swimming pool,…
Located in Athens, 1.1 km and 3 metro stops away from the Acropolis Museum, ibis Styles Athens Routes provides accommodation with private…
Attractively situated in Athens, Athens One Smart Hotel features air-conditioned rooms, a fitness centre, free WiFi and a shared lounge.
Grand Hyatt Athens, opened in August 2018, boasts a brand new spa, atrium pool & bar and a rooftop with stunning views over the Acropolis.
Situated in Athens, 400 metres from Museum of Cycladic Art, St George Lycabettus Lifestyle Hotel features accommodation with a restaurant,…
Just 800 metres from the world-renowned Acropolis and Acropolis Museum, Elia Ermou Athens Hotel is conveniently set in the heart of Athens.
This luxury Athens hotel is ideally situated in the heart of Athens. It boasts a rooftop pool with Acropolis view, and offers exquisite…
Housed in an industrial building featuring a steel and glass facade, Kubic Athens is a smart hotel centrally located in Athens.
Within a few minutes from the business and historical centre of Athens, this elegant boutique hotel is ideally situated.
Ideally set in the centre of Athens, Academias Hotel, Autograph Collection features free WiFi throughout the property and a bar.
The modern Airotel Stratos Vassilikos Hotel is situated a 5-minute walk from the Megaro Mousikis Metro Station and features a modern lobby…